Family: | Catostomidae (Suckers), subfamily: Catostominae | |||
Max. size: | 35 cm TL (male/unsexed) | |||
Environment: | demersal; freshwater, potamodromous | |||
Distribution: | North America: restricted to Warner Lake basin in southern Oregon, USA. | |||
Diagnosis: | ||||
Biology: | Occurs in lakes, pools and runs of streams and large irrigation canals. | |||
IUCN Red List Status: | Endangered (EN); Date assessed: 01 November 2011 (B1ac(ii)+2ac(ii)) Ref. (126983) | |||
Threat to humans: | harmless |
